I know other people are having this problem but I have not found a solution for it yet!
I am unable to create missions because when I go to test them in multiplayer I get the following: Connection to Steam lost Exiting Server failed to connect to steam Firstly I never had this problem until the last steam COD patch of maybe it was a Steam update that caused the problem not sure!. Secondly it is unlikely to be hardware specific as I have just replaced my Main board recently and still have the same problem ! And yes i have all the latest drivers and windows updates. Any help would be much appreciated. Regards xpupx |

I have the same problem and went through the whole troubleshooting with steam Tech support without any results.
They finally told me that they can't do anything and that I have to ask the 1C tech support for help. steam tech support roughly told me this: Do a selective startup Disable firewall Disable AV Uninstall AV Reset Steam to Default settings by clearing it. None of these was a solution. |
